英文摘要
Agent-based modelling (ABM) is rapidly becoming established as a standard tool for the socialscientist. Its ability to represent individuals, their unique characteristics and behaviour providea template for allowing simulations of human behaviour to be created. Typically, theapplication systems that ABMs are used to replicate, for example cities, are heavily imbuedwith complexity and non-linear dynamics. However, we lack the tools to understand theinterplay of these dynamics and the part they play in the final model output. This is particularlyimportant if we are to create robust models that can be used within the policy arena. This isalso timely; the growth in new forms of individual micro-data (big data) will only increase thepotential for ABM to give new insights into how individuals use and interact with systems.Using the outputs for several scenarios such as health or retail related, from a city levelABM, this PhD will evaluate and apply a range of techniques from Machine Learning (ML)for uncovering the inner-workings of ABM. This will give insight into which processes themodel is, and is not replicating well. Specifically, the aims will be:1 Critical evaluation of different techniques from ML - which offers the greatestpotential for understanding the interplay of ABM rules? This will include bothmethods for visualisation of the system as well as statistical appraisal.2 Adaption of these approaches for application to ABM outputs3 Application of ML approaches to ABM outputs and critical evaluation.The outputs of this PhD will be the application of one or more ML inspired approaches thatwill shed light on the black box nature of ABM.
